ServerToClientAdapter

Struct ServerToClientAdapter 

Source
pub struct ServerToClientAdapter { /* private fields */ }
Expand description

Adapter that implements the ServerToClientRequests trait by delegating to BidirectionalRouter.

This adapter bridges the gap between the generic ServerToClientRequests trait (defined in turbomcp-protocol) and the concrete BidirectionalRouter implementation (in turbomcp-server).

§Thread Safety

This adapter is Send + Sync because:

  • BidirectionalRouter implements Clone and contains only Arc<dyn ServerRequestDispatcher>
  • All interior state is immutable after construction

§Performance

Zero-overhead abstraction:

  • No intermediate serialization (types flow directly through)
  • One Arc clone when creating the adapter (shared state)
  • Direct delegation to underlying router (no indirection)
  • Context propagation with zero allocation

§Design Improvement (v2.0.0)

Previously named ServerCapabilitiesAdapter, this was renamed to ServerToClientAdapter for clarity and redesigned to eliminate double serialization.

impl ServerToClientAdapter

Source

pub fn new(bidirectional: BidirectionalRouter) -> Self

Create a new adapter wrapping a bidirectional router.

§Example
use turbomcp_server::capabilities::ServerToClientAdapter;
use turbomcp_server::routing::BidirectionalRouter;

let router = BidirectionalRouter::new();
let adapter = ServerToClientAdapter::new(router);
Source

pub fn supports_bidirectional(&self) -> bool

Check if bidirectional communication is supported.

Returns true if a dispatcher has been configured, false otherwise.
